Overview

What DATEV does

DATEV eG is a registered cooperative founded in 1966, owned by its roughly 40,000 members, who are tax advisers, auditors and lawyers rather than ordinary businesses. Its catalogue covers financial accounting, payroll (Lohn und Gehalt), annual accounts, tax return preparation, cash books, document management and the DATEV Unternehmen online portal that companies use to hand receipts and bank data to their adviser. What distinguishes it commercially is the ownership structure and the channel that follows from it. DATEV is not trying to sell to you, it is trying to serve the adviser who serves you, and product decisions follow the German professional workflow and the ELSTER, GoBD and DSGVO obligations that come with it. That makes it very hard to leave: your bookkeeping history, chart of accounts (SKR03 or SKR04) and payroll records sit in your adviser's DATEV installation, and switching accounting software usually means switching adviser too, or paying them to work in something they do not know. Buyers are German Mittelstand companies, plus their tax firms. The trade off is that DATEV is built for German statutory practice first and modern software conventions second. Interfaces are dated, several modules still assume a Windows desktop, and if you operate outside the German-speaking market you will run a second system alongside it. DATEV publishes a Preisliste PDF but the effective cost you pay is set by your adviser as part of their fee, not by DATEV.

What people use it for

  • A German GmbH that wants its Steuerberater to keep doing the books but wants receipts to stop travelling in a shoebox
  • A payroll department that must file social insurance and wage tax returns to German statutory deadlines without an external bureau
  • An SME preparing an e-Bilanz and audit-ready GoBD document archive
  • A tax firm standardising dozens of client engagements on one chart of accounts and one document workflow

The honest half

Where it falls short

Concrete and checkable, so you can decide whether any of them matter to you. This is the half of a review a vendor will not write about DATEV.

  • DATEV does not publish transparent per-customer pricing the way a SaaS vendor does; your real cost is buried in your tax adviser's fee note, so comparing it against Lexware or sevdesk on price is genuinely hard.
  • The board has decided to wind down the Austria-specific portfolio: existing products remain usable to 31 December 2028, are free of charge during 2029, and cannot be used after 31 December 2029, so any Austrian entity on DATEV has a forced migration dated in advance.
  • It is built for German statutory practice, so a group with subsidiaries outside the DACH region will run DATEV for Germany and something else everywhere else, with a consolidation step in between.
  • Large parts of the suite are still Windows desktop software installed on a workstation or terminal server, which means IT overhead most companies no longer budget for when they think they are buying cloud accounting.
  • The lock-in is social as well as technical: because your adviser holds the installation and the history, changing accounting software usually forces you to change or retrain your adviser, which is a far bigger decision than a software migration.

Capabilities

Features

  • Unternehmen online

    Client portal for uploading receipts, bank transactions and cash book entries to the adviser

  • Lohn und Gehalt

    German payroll including social insurance, wage tax registration and electronic returns

  • Rechnungswesen

    Double-entry financial accounting on SKR03 and SKR04 standard charts of accounts

  • Jahresabschluss

    Statutory annual accounts and e-Bilanz submission to the tax authority

  • DATEV DMS

    Audit-safe document archive meeting GoBD retention rules

  • Meine Steuern

    Client-side collection of personal income tax documents for the adviser

  • DATEV-Schnittstelle

    The export format that nearly every German ERP and invoicing tool implements for adviser handover

Can I buy DATEV directly without a tax adviser?

In practice, no for most of the range. Membership of the cooperative is restricted to the tax and legal professions, and companies get access through their adviser or as a client of one.

Is DATEV usable outside Germany?

It operates in Austria, Italy, Spain, Poland, Czechia, Slovakia and Hungary, but the depth is German. The Austrian product line is being discontinued with a hard end date of 31 December 2029.

What is the DATEV-Schnittstelle everyone mentions?

It is the standard export format German invoicing and ERP tools produce so bookkeeping data can be handed to a DATEV-based adviser. Supporting it is effectively a requirement to sell accounting-adjacent software in Germany.

Does DATEV handle e-invoicing under the German B2B mandate?

Yes, the accounting and invoicing modules were extended for the XRechnung and ZUGFeRD formats that the German B2B e-invoicing rules require.
